Tornado activity:

Watertown-area historical tornado activity is slightly above Tennessee state average. It is 66% greater than the overall U.S. average.

On 1/24/1997, a category F4 (max. wind speeds 207-260 mph) tornado 23.1 miles away from the Watertown city center injured 18 people and caused $5 million in damages.

On 4/3/1974, a category F5 (max. wind speeds 261-318 mph) tornado 42.2 miles away from the city center killed 16 people and injured 190 people.

Earthquake activity:

Watertown-area historical earthquake activity is significantly above Tennessee state average. It is 163% greater than the overall U.S. average.

On 4/18/2008 at 09:36:59, a magnitude 5.4 (5.1 MB, 4.8 MS, 5.4 MW, 5.2 MW, Class: Moderate, Intensity: VI - VII) earthquake occurred 189.0 miles away from Watertown center
On 4/29/2003 at 08:59:39, a magnitude 4.9 (4.4 MB, 4.6 MW, 4.9 LG, Class: Light, Intensity: IV - V) earthquake occurred 114.7 miles away from the city center
On 4/18/2008 at 09:36:59, a magnitude 5.2 (5.2 MW, Depth: 8.9 mi) earthquake occurred 189.0 miles away from the city center
On 7/27/1980 at 18:52:21, a magnitude 5.2 (5.1 MB, 4.7 MS, 5.0 UK, 5.2 UK) earthquake occurred 189.3 miles away from the city center
On 6/18/2002 at 17:37:15, a magnitude 5.0 (4.3 MB, 4.6 MW, 5.0 LG) earthquake occurred 158.9 miles away from Watertown center
On 11/30/1973 at 07:48:41, a magnitude 4.7 (4.7 MB, 4.6 ML) earthquake occurred 123.6 miles away from Watertown center
Magnitude types: regional Lg-wave magnitude (LG), body-wave magnitude (MB), local magnitude (ML), surface-wave magnitude (MS), moment magnitude (MW)

2002 - 2018 National Fire Incident Reporting System (NFIRS) incidents

    Fire incident distribution by year Based on the data from the years 2002 - 2018 the average number of fire incidents per year is 32. The highest number of fire incidents - 71 took place in 2007, and the least - 2 in 2002. The data has an increasing trend.
    Fire incident types in Watertown, TN When looking into fire subcategories, the most reports belonged to: Outside Fires (45.4%), and Structure Fires (39.5%).
